The Zenbook 14X OLED starts at $1399 USD with the Core i7-1165G7 CPU, ScreenPad 2.0, and GeForce MX450 GPU while the Zenbook Flip OLED starts at $1099 USD with the Ryzen 7 5800H. Both models carry the same 16:10 2.8K OLED touchscreen but with very different chassis designs.
